Job Description
Do you enjoy developing highly available, low latent micro-services that interact with large data sets? Are you interested in helping advanced analytics propel the business forward?
You’ll be working in the Cyber Security organization. You’ll be working on a dynamic team who is constantly flexing to meet the needs of the business and next generation cloud technologies. ( Kafka, Elasticsearch, AWS, Logstash )
Responsibilities
- Develop, coach and mentor other software engineers on the best practices providing domain and technical best practice guidance.
- Write services and unit tests to provide code coverage looking for the code coverage to go up over time.
- Own the run time performance of your service and code ensuring it’s behaving as expected.
- In a team setting with other DevOps engineers, design and build tools and automation scripts that enable data scientists and business analysts to easily consume cloud-native services.
- Technical point of contact for product teams as it relates to automation, CI/CD, and DevOps.
- Developing secure design patterns for analytics architectures deployed in the public cloud and/or orchestrated container environments using a ‘security first’ mindset.
- Build automation to actively audit the infrastructure for misconfigurations.
- Develop container image life cycle management systems.
- Ability to adapt communication for effectiveness with business partners and other technical teams.
- Works with key stakeholders to design complex solutions and lead from inception to production
- Creates and maintains devops processes, application infrastructure, and utilizes cloud services (including database systems and models)
- Innovates on and advocates for best practices and improved team processes; mentors junior team members
- Develops and maintains complex front-ends with a focus on user experience
- Develops and maintains backend systems.
Minimum Qualifications
At a minimum, here’s what we need from you:
- Bachelor’s degree in information technology or related field
- 6+ years of experience in computer science, information technology or related field
- In lieu of degree, 8+ years of experience in computer science, information technology or related field
Preferred Qualifications:
- Experience developing Java, Python and Scala services in a highly available environment using proper design patterns.
- Proven experience in software development methodologies.
- Strong analytical skills.
- The ability to multi-task
- Knowledge of working with CI/CD pipelines to ensure automated build, testing, and deployment using Gradle, Jenkins.
- Good communication skills.
- Experience writing unit and service level tests to ensure adequate code coverage, preferably using Junit and Mockito.
- Experience with NoSQL databases.
- Working familiarity of Docker and other containerization technologies providing horizontal scaling such as Kubernetes or Openshift.
- Understanding of messaging systems like MQ, Rabbit MQ, Kafka, or Kinesis.
- Experience as part of an Agile engineering or development team
- Strong understanding of object-oriented principles with an ability to write clean code
- Strong experience working with a relational database
- Proven skills in high availability and scalability design, as well as performance monitoring
- Experience in working in a cloud environment such as AWS, GCP or Azure.
- Build secure web applications with user authentication
